Take cooling, for example. AI workloads are pushing energy use to new extremes, with resources and systems struggling to keep up. That’s why we developed our global data center solutions organization and launched products like the YORK YVAM chiller – engineered to operate without consuming water, deliver up to 40% energy savings, and perform predictably and reliably whether it’s installed in Dublin or Dubai. It’s one design, any location. That kind of consistency matters when uptime is non-negotiable.

Security is another area where we’re helping customers stay ahead. Our systems can recognize and track up to 75 distinct objects, including license plates, people, and backpacks as they move through a facility, all while applying granular access controls and real-time threat detection. These innovations mean we are able to help customers protect their assets without slowing down operations.
As data centers generate more heat, the likelihood of fire increases, but our fire detection systems can provide early warning hours before any risk becomes critical. And if suppression is needed, we use mist systems that remove heat without flooding the space or displacing oxygen. It’s safer for people, and better for equipment.
